Crosby skates … Kane out 6-8 weeks … Campoli done with ‘Hawks … Nothing going on with Parise’s contract … Larsson signs with Devils

  • Larry Fine in the Globe and Mail: Sidney Crosby has begun on-ice workouts. Crosby has been training in Halifax, Nova Scotia. It’s still unknown if he’ll be ready for training camp, and he hasn’t been given clearance by doctors for physical contact.
  • Adam Jahns of the Chicago Sun-Times: Patrick Kane will require surgery on his left wrist. He had tests on his wrist during the playoffs, but it didn’t reveal a fracture. Kane is expected to miss 6 to 8 weeks.

    “I thought it was getting better, but it’s in an area where no blood can get to the fracture and something I’m going to have fixed for later down the road,” said Kane, who wore a brace. “It’s one of those things, I fix it out now it’s not going to affect me when the season comes.

    The Blackhawks have decided to walk away from RFA Chris Campoli, who has an arbitration hearing on August 3rd.

    “It was apparent from the beginning that their salary demands were not in concert with where we see him fitting in our team,” Bowman said. “The dollar that they’re looking for is not agreeable with our mixture. If we don’t trade him, then he will become an unrestricted free agent.”

    The Blackshawks have signed defenseman Sami Lepisto to a one year deal. They also re-signed Micheal Frolik to a 3 year, $7 million deal.

  • Adam Jahns via twitter: GM Bowman on Campoli: “We went back and forth and made him our best offer and it didn’t work for them.”
  • Randy Sportak of the Calgary Sun: The Flames have re-signed Brendan Morrison to a 1 year deal worth $850,000 is base salary and up to $400,000 in bonuses. The Flames are now close to the cap, and have too many forwards. They may look at stashing someone in the minors. The best case scenario for the Flames would be for another team to believe in Niklas Hagman or Matt Stajan and would send a draft pick back.
  • Tom Gulitti via twitter: Yesterday morning Zach Parise sent Gulitti an email saying that nothing was going on regarding his contract.
  • Tom Gulitti via twitter: Adam Larsson signed a 3 year entry-level contract with the NJ Devils. The deal does not include any performance bonuses. Larsson made the decision to sign a deal without performance bonuses, he did get a signing bonus. Lamorielllo on Larsson: “That’s a decision the player made to be part of the Devils and not to be any different than anyone else in that locker room.” Lamoriello added that they and Larsson expect him to play in either the NHL or AHL next season. His deal carries a $925,000 cap hit.
  • Arthur Staple via twitter:The Islanders and RFA Josh Baily are still talking about a new deal.
